Job Summary

As part of Purdue University, you will help support the daily operations of a collaborative, service-focused team by providing welcoming and reliable administrative assistance to faculty, staff, students, visitors, and callers. In this role, you will serve as a first point of contact, helping connect people with information, resources, and support while creating a positive experience for those who engage with the department. You will also help keep the office running smoothly by drafting routine correspondence, scheduling appointments and meetings, organizing and maintaining paper and electronic files, distributing mail, preparing copies, and assisting with general office needs. Your attention to detail, professionalism, and commitment to service will help advance Purdue’s mission and support the important work happening across the university.

Under direct supervision, you provide general administrative support for an individual, group of professionals, department, program or other administrative function. Serve as first point of contact. Draft routine correspondence, schedule appointments, organize and maintain paper and electronic files, or provide information to callers and visitors. Assist with various other support functions as needed.



About Purdue University
Purdue University is a public research institution demonstrating excellence at scale. Ranked among top 10 public universities and with two colleges in the top four in the United States, Purdue discovers and disseminates knowledge with a quality and at a scale second to none. More than 105,000 students study at Purdue across modalities and locations, including nearly 50,000 in person on the West Lafayette campus. Committed to affordability and accessibility, Purdue’s main campus has frozen tuition 13 years in a row.
